Artur Davis, a native son of Montgomery, Ala., left the state to earn his bachelor's degree
at Boston University and law degree at Harvard. During college, he interned for the late Alabama Sen. Howell Heflin.
U.S. Representative Artur Davis was reelected in 2008 to serve his fourth term in the U.S. House
of Representatives. He represents Alabama’s Seventh Congressional District, a twelve county area that spans from Birmingham
and Tuscaloosa to the Black Belt.
In a relatively short period
of time, Davis has made his mark as an effective legislator who was won national attention for his leadership on a range of
issues. He serves as a member of the prestigious Ways and Means Committee, which oversees economic policy. Davis is only the
tenth Alabamian in 190 years to serve on this committee, which is the only congressional committee actually described in the
Constitution.
Davis has already won several
notable legislative victories that have benefitted both the urban and rural portions of his congressional district. When Republicans
controlled Congress, his skill at forging bipartisan coalitions helped him pass legislation to save the HOPE VI program for
revitalizing public housing communities. During the Democratic majority, Davis was the leading force behind reopening the
Pigford black farmers lawsuit. He has also been a persuasive voice for creative ideas that would expand health care and improve
educational performance.
Congressman Davis, a Montgomery
native, graduated with honors from both Harvard University and Harvard Law School and has had a nearly 15 year career in public
service. As a law student, he worked for the Southern Poverty Law Center and U.S. Senator Howell Heflin. From 1994 –
1998, he compiled a near 100% trial conviction record as a federal prosecutor in Montgomery. From 1998-2002, Congressman Davis
worked as a litigator in private practice.

Creating Jobs & Transforming our Economy
With unemployment in double digits in half our counties, Artur Davis knows we
must do something different when it comes to economic development. That’s why he supports establishing a new cabinet
level office to recruit industry to distressed rural counties. Davis will also focus on drawing new job sources to our state,
in industries like alternative energy production, information technology and bio-medicine. He will draw on national expertise
to foster broadband deployment in rural communities. By preparing for the future, Alabama can become a beacon for growing
new industries that will sustain economic growth for a generation.
Davis recognizes that while we must recruit new industries, sustaining existing
businesses is also essential. He will expand the mission of the Alabama Development Office to develop strategies for
retaining existing industries and trouble-shooting companies that may be on the verge of closing their Alabama operations.
Reforming Public Schools & Protecting
the PACT Program
Alabama’s drop-out rate has consistently
been among the worst in America. Davis knows the status quo is not a viable solution to improve public schools in Alabama.
He understands that well before high school, too many kids begin to lag behind their peers in their basic cognitive abilities.
That’s why he will expand an array of programs that strengthen early childhood development. Davis believes
pre-Kindergarten, afterschool programs and character education are critical to providing students with the support they need
to succeed at an early age.
Because our children are just as likely
to be competing for a job with a child from Taiwan as they are a child from Tennessee, Davis will renew Alabama’s commitment
to science and math education to better prepare our children for the jobs of the 21st Century. Davis does not fear
reform and will join President Obama in supporting charter schools that can introduce innovation to education in communities
around our state.
And Davis believes that money should never
be a reason to keep young people out of college. That’s why he’ll fulfill the moral commitment to families
and individuals who invested in Alabama’s PACT program and ensure that every dollar invested is protected. He will also
end the days of Alabama ranking at the bottom when it comes to the amount of state assistance to moderate and low income college

Ethics Reform & Restoring Confidence in Government
It’s
been a generation since Alabama reformed our ethics laws for elected officials. The recent outbreak of indictments and
convictions of public officials has brought into clear view the need for real reform. That’s why Davis supports
a special session of the Legislature to pass new laws that would impose a total gift ban on lobbyists; enact conflict of interest
rules that would stop lawmakers from using their influence to benefit their employers; ban PAC to PAC transfers; cap contributions
to campaigns; and require public officials indicted for misusing their office to step aside until they can clear their name.
